3.9.2
Design Points and Recommended Circuit
For detailed information about USB 2.0 specifications, access http://www.usb.org/home.
Figure 3-12 illustrates a circuit recommended for the USB interface. To ensure that
subsequent commissioning and upgrading operations can be smoothly performed, customers
need to design a USB 2.0 connector on an external system board. ZTE recommends the
following model: MOLEX: 1051330001 and LS: GU073-5P-SE-E2000. The bead in Figure
3-14 can be replaced with a resistor. If no high-speed data services are involved and the USB
differential signals are properly protected, the common mode inductor can be removed.
